Nerve cells have amazing strategies to save energy and still perform the most important of their tasks. Researchers from the University Hospital Bonn (UKB) and the University of Bonn as well as the University Medical Center Göttingen found that the neuronal energy conservation program determines the location and number of messenger RNA (mRNA) and proteins and differs depending on the length, longevity and other properties of the respective molecule. The work has now been published in Nature Communications. Nerve cells have amazing strategies to save energy and still perform the most important of their tasks.
